Cat stinks of manure – causes
If your cat is a free roamer and does not move only in a secured garden, the probable cause for the stench and feces-smeared fur is the direct contact to liquid manure.
This is primarily spread on fields as fertilizer in the spring. Plant slurry has a similarly unpleasant odor and is also used by amateur gardeners in their own greenery.
So, if your cat has roamed a field or a neighbor’s garden, hunted or even taken a nap, the fur may take on the odor or be smeared with the substances.
If your cat is very dirty, it may have been doused with it by someone, fallen into a pit or played in a manure pile.
Another possible cause is health problems of your cat. In this case, you will notice soiling only on the face or anus – if it is there at all.
In the case of wounds or illnesses, an unpleasant odor may also emanate from your pet. In these cases, you need to see a vet immediately.
Distinguish between pollution and disease
Free-rangers have a much higher risk of coming into contact with manure and slurry. They also run the risk of being injured during a fight, hurting themselves or contracting an infection.
So distinguishing between the two is more difficult with a smelly cat. If it smells just like the field next door after fertilizing, the connection is obvious, of course.
Nevertheless, you should check her for sores after every walk and observe her behavior. If she seems to be tired in addition to the smell, a disease can be hidden behind the stench.
In apartment cats that only use the balcony or a secured area in the garden, diseases are more likely.
If you notice any changes in their behavior or if the smell recurs despite extensive care, consult a veterinarian immediately.
Cleaning cat fur – this is how to do it
Many still advise against bathing cats. Don’t worry, with the right procedure you won’t harm your cat.
For you and if necessary a helper it is however quite connected with a certain danger.
In addition, it is not always necessary to directly fill a tub. To the selection stand to you:
Cat dry shampoo
care spray against fur smell
wet cleaning with cat shampoo
Bathing
So, depending on the degree of dirtiness of your cat, you can use different methods to help him groom and clean.
Cat dry shampoo and grooming spray
In case of an unpleasant but rather light smell and no visible dirt, you can use dry shampoo or grooming spray.
The application is very simple: work the powder or spray into the coat as instructed by the manufacturer, let it work and then brush it out to remove residues.
Slight odors should disappear in the process. Is this measure still not enough? Then check out the following options.
Moist coat cleaning for cats
For light soiling and smelly fur, it also does not have to be a full bath for the cat.
In many cases, washcloths, a little shampoo and water, and towels are enough. Then you proceed in the following steps:
Prepare a solution of warm water and shampoo.
Soak a washcloth with it and wring it out only so far that it no longer drips heavily.
Now soak the coat carefully in stroking movements down to the skin. This should gradually loosen all dirt.
Treat gradually all affected areas of the coat with it.
Then use a fresh washcloth and clear water to remove the shampoo residue.
Again, use stroking motions to squeeze the water out of the coat and gently dry your cat. Especially for cats with long fur, you should avoid rubbing, as this will knot the fur hairs.
Bathing cats – but correctly
If your cat is very dirty, you can’t avoid giving him a bath. This is especially true in the case of direct contact with manure and animal slurry.
The cause is not only the intense stench. A high concentration of dangerous bacteria can also be found in the animal excrement. These include Clostridium botulinum.
They produce a neurotoxin that you are certainly familiar with from another context: Botox.
What works against wrinkles in beauty treatments can lead to the death of your cat if ingested uncontrolled and undiluted.
So if she has rolled directly in it on a field freshly covered with liquid manure, cleaning herself is a high risk.
In order not to run this risk, you should bathe your animal. Since most cats are afraid of water, this is often difficult.
However, with the following procedure, it can be done as gently as possible.
You will need:
Washcloth
towels
Measuring cup
cat shampoo
one or two buckets
If necessary, a child’s bathtub or a smaller laundry tub.
Put all the utensils within easy reach. Letting your cat loose while bathing or drying will end in a bathroom flood.
- Fill the buckets with warm – but not hot – water.
- Drop enough water into the bathtub or laundry tub so that your cat will be standing in it up to about his belly. Add shampoo and dissolve it well in it.
- Now put your cat carefully into the tub and hold it tightly. After a moment of getting used to it, you can start to soak and clean the fur piece by piece from the bottom up with a wet washcloth. Try to imitate the licking movements of the mother. This has a calming effect on many cats.
- When cleaning the face, make sure that neither water nor foam can get into the eyes, nose, mouth or ears.
- When your cat is completely clean, drain the water from the tub.
- Now take the measuring cup and clear water from the buckets to rinse the coat, removing any residue from the shampoo.
Brush water out of the coat, dry it with light pressure with the towels, and then keep your cat warm until the coat is completely dry.
Our tip: Some cats like to bathe and are surprisingly relaxed about it. However, this is the exception and not the rule. So if you must bathe your cat, it’s best to find a helper to hold the animal while you do the washing.
Preventing stinky cat fur
With outdoor cats, you can prevent stinky fur only to a limited extent by keeping them indoors during the fertilizing season of fields.
In any case, you should get your pets used to regular and comprehensive grooming.
This will make it much easier to give them a thorough cleaning when needed, or to help them do so if they are sick or have mobility problems.
If the cat smells like manure and slurry
Clean the coat quickly and thoroughly to remove the bacteria and other potentially dangerous substances.
Following wet cleaning or bathing, avoid cold and drafts. Otherwise, there is a risk for illness.
Also, try to avoid direct contact with dangerous fertilizers by avoiding outdoor access during the period of use.
